Output 3dd90bf70766e972835437948c9014406d14ccac8d4af6b81ebcfd49e7d719bb:1

value
1000487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f49e9e13503f17801047f34f00ce42b2cce265f OP_EQUAL
address
34YTR6aP5nK99CFDCzSh1sBPCF2rz1RgTs
transaction
3dd90bf70766e972835437948c9014406d14ccac8d4af6b81ebcfd49e7d719bb
spent
true